Sexism scandal over Nikita Mazepin von Haas


Munich – Scandal about Mick Schumacher’s future teammates in Formula 1: The Russian Nikita Mazepin caused outrage with a sexist video on his Instagram channel and must now even fear for his place at the Haas racing team.

The US team responded with clear words on Wednesday morning.

“Haas does not condone Nikita Mazepin’s behavior in the recently posted video,” the statement said: “We find the mere fact that this video was published to be disgusting.”

Mazepin was sitting in the passenger seat of a car, in the short clip the 21-year-old films how he grabs a woman sitting in the back seat by the breast. This defends itself against it. The video was quickly deleted.

Mazepin apologizes

Haas will now clarify the matter “internally” and will not comment further for the time being. In an initial response, Mazepin apologized for his “inappropriate” behavior.

Like Schumacher, he was still racing in Formula 2 this season, and next year he will make his debut in the premier class alongside the German. In the past, Masepin has repeatedly attracted attention for his lack of discipline.
